WebUsing your index finger and thumb, pinch along the putty, making little indents along the length of the putty. Do this 10-20 times. Change up the type of pinch by placing your thumb on top and pinching toward your index finger. Again do this 10-20 times. Try different pinches with your thumb for a total of 2-3 minutes.

WebFeb 1, 2003 · There are 11 intrinsic muscles and 15 extrinsic muscles with direct functional roles in the hand. Extrinsic and intrinsic hand muscles produce the force required for gripping objects (grip force). After 60 years of age there is a rapid decline in hand-grip strength, by as much as 20–25% (16, 17).
